What's This Course About

Curious about how the Internet of Things (IoT) is reshaping the world around you? This IoT Fundamentals for Beginners course offers a solid foundation for understanding this transformative technology. Learn the basics of how smart devices communicate, collect data, and interact with the environment. Explore key IoT components such as sensors, actuators, and network protocols, providing you with the essential knowledge to understand and engage with IoT systems.

Beyond the fundamental concepts, this course dives into practical applications. Learn how to analyze data from IoT devices, enabling informed decision-making. You will also discover how IoT is applied across various sectors, such as healthcare, smart cities, and industrial automation. By grasping these concepts and their real-world applications, you will be well-equipped to navigate the ever-expanding landscape of IoT, whether for personal interest or professional advancement.

What You'll Learn

Topic 1 Overview of Internet of Things (IoT)

  • What is IoT?
  • Sensors and Actuators for IoT
  • Wireless Communication Technologies for IoT
  • IoT Applications and Use Cases

Topic 2 Collect and Post Data to Cloud

  • Cloud Computing for IoT
  • Setup Cloud Computing Account
  • Collect Data with Sensors
  • Transmit Data using ESP8266
  • Post Data to Cloud using MQTT or REST API

Topic 3 Read Data and Remote Control Devices from Cloud

  • Read Data using MQTT or REST API
  • Remote Control Devices from Cloud

Topic 4 IoT Data Analytics and Visualization

  • Analyze IoT Data on Cloud
  • Visualize IoT Data on Cloud
  • IoT Security

Shawn Koh Boon Hiap is a ACTA certified trainer and used to be a specialist trainer in RSAF training specialists and officers. He was also invited by Prime Minister Office on Dec 2019 as guest speaker for Smart Nation event held in Downtown East. Throughout his career in the corporate world, he was also coach and mentor to many others, often relinquishing his leadership to take on more challenging tasks after imparting his knowledge and skillsets to his successors. Shawn is skilled in IoT integrations and development, network administration, system administration, website development, software development, multimedia production, information security, entrepreneurship, corporate leadership and project management. He is a corporate leader and turned as entrepreneur, is the founder of I.O.T. Workz, a Smart Nation ambassador, offering integrated IoT solutions for residential, commercial and industrial. He was a self-learned programmer and won the National Software Competition North Zone Champion in 1990. He developed the first predictive online-data reduction system in 1996 for the Command and Control (C2) Center in RSAF to provide real-time system health monitoring in the data center. He also formed the Ground-Based Radar System team in ST Electronics (InfoSoft) to provide software maintenance for all radar systems in Singapore between 2003 and 2006. He was also the solution architect for multiple generations of Derivatives Clearing Systems, Head of Enterprise Solutions and held a couple of other leadership roles in SGX between 2007 and 2018. Throughout his years of exposure with Technology, he had mastered many different programming languages, acquired electronics troubleshooting skills and earn professional certifications in PMP, Information Security, Linux Administration and many others.
